Searched around, but couldn't find any posts regarding adjusting the forward controls. Manual says to contact the dealer to do it, but seems it should be easy enough to do. Just looking for some general guidance so I don't screw it up. Thanks!
 
You're going to have to define "adjust". You can adjust the position of the whole assembly forward or backwards, you can adjust the shifter position up and down to better fit boots. In either case, it's very straight forward and certainly doesn't require paying the dealer to do it. If you're moving the footrests forward or backwards, you may need to use or store an shift linkage extension bar in the "tool" location under the right side panel.
 
The forwards on the GT come from the factory in the middle position. I moved mine to the rearmost position, and in doing so was required to also swap out the linkage rod and adjust to suit me. The move rearward put the shifter peg in an un reachable position for my foot.
